When I cleared out my garden shed this spring I found a pile of empty snail shells in a corner. All had neat hole in the shell from where I guess they were attacked and disposed of. Any ideas what is doing this? What ever it is it is very welcome in my snail infested garden and I would like to encourage it.

You may not want to hear this, but Rats eat snails too... by punching a small hole in the shell and sucking them out ;o(
Rats also pile the shells up.
